Nurys Camargo

Vice President of Member Services

Nurys Camargo serves as Vice President of Member Services at the Associated Industries of Massachusetts (AIM), where she leads efforts to engage and grow AIM’s diverse membership community. In this role, Nurys focuses on delivering exceptional service, building strong relationships with members, and ensuring that AIM provides meaningful value to businesses across the Commonwealth.

Nurys has held leadership roles at the Massachusetts Cannabis Control Commission, AT&T New England, and the Executive Office of Public Safety and Security, building statewide programs that support diverse constituencies and deliver organizational impact. She is also the founder of Chica Project, a nonprofit focused on leadership development for young women of color.

She holds an MPA from Baruch College and a BS in Criminal Justice from Mount Ida College. She has been recognized as one of the 100 Most Influential Bostonians and a Top 100 Influential Person of Color in Massachusetts.

Outside of work, Nurys enjoys fishing, reading, and observing the world around her.
